Thanks SandS, it was an awesome paddle. Basically the ace is my first sup so I can't compare to other boards. Don't really know any different. Feel I'm getting more relaxed on the ace as I paddle more and more...it is a wild ride though. You can never really trully relax. PT woody once described the ride on an ace to me as "...like riding a wild horse, it's exciting, it's fast and furious and you are always on the edge. A board like a naish glide or similar is more of a zen like experience". After a few months on the ace I totally agree with him.
